CVE-2020-2691 Explained : Impact and Mitigation

Learn about CVE-2020-2691, a vulnerability in Oracle VM VirtualBox that allows unauthorized access to critical data. Find out the impacted versions and mitigation steps.

A vulnerability in Oracle VM VirtualBox could allow unauthorized access to critical data or compromise the system.

Understanding CVE-2020-2691

This CVE involves a vulnerability in Oracle VM VirtualBox that could be exploited by a low-privileged attacker to compromise the system.

What is CVE-2020-2691?

The vulnerability in Oracle VM VirtualBox allows attackers with login access to compromise the system, potentially leading to unauthorized data access.

The Impact of CVE-2020-2691

        The vulnerability has a CVSS 3.0 Base Score of 6.5 (Confidentiality impacts).
        Successful exploitation can result in unauthorized access to critical data or complete access to all Oracle VM VirtualBox data.

Technical Details of CVE-2020-2691

This section provides technical details about the vulnerability.

Vulnerability Description

        Vulnerability in Oracle VM VirtualBox product of Oracle Virtualization (component: Core).
        Easily exploitable by a low-privileged attacker with login access.

Affected Systems and Versions

        Affected versions include those prior to 5.2.36, 6.0.16, and 6.1.2 of Oracle VM VirtualBox.

Exploitation Mechanism

        Low privileged attacker with logon access can compromise Oracle VM VirtualBox.

Mitigation and Prevention

Steps to address and prevent the CVE-2020-2691 vulnerability.

Immediate Steps to Take

        Update Oracle VM VirtualBox to versions 5.2.36, 6.0.16, or 6.1.2 to mitigate the vulnerability.
        Monitor system logs for any suspicious activities.

Long-Term Security Practices

        Implement the principle of least privilege to restrict user access.
        Regularly update and patch software to prevent vulnerabilities.

Patching and Updates

        Apply security patches provided by Oracle to address the vulnerability.
